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
W
warehouse
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
胡懿
warehouse
Commits
b8309d91
Commit
b8309d91
authored
Jun 09, 2023
by
yyq1988
Browse files
Options
Browse Files
Download
Plain Diff
Merge remote-tracking branch 'origin/master'
parents
3a614492
cf1b65c6
Show whitespace changes
Inline
Side-by-side
Showing
5 changed files
with
25 additions
and
6 deletions
+25
-6
IKSegmenter.java
...com/jeeplus/modules/warehouse/ikanalyzer/IKSegmenter.java
+1
-1
LedgerService.java
...eplus/modules/warehouse/ledger/service/LedgerService.java
+8
-0
QrCodeMapper.xml
...plus/modules/warehouse/qrcode/mapper/xml/QrCodeMapper.xml
+0
-1
StorageService.java
...lus/modules/warehouse/storage/service/StorageService.java
+15
-3
StorageController.java
...plus/modules/warehouse/storage/web/StorageController.java
+1
-1
No files found.
src/main/java/com/jeeplus/modules/warehouse/ikanalyzer/IKSegmenter.java
View file @
b8309d91
...
...
@@ -49,7 +49,7 @@ public class IKSegmenter {
e
.
printStackTrace
();
}
List
<
String
>
list
=
new
ArrayList
<>();
String
[]
strArr
=
strs
.
split
(
"
|
"
);
String
[]
strArr
=
strs
.
split
(
"
[|]
"
);
for
(
String
str
:
strArr
)
{
list
.
add
(
str
);
}
...
...
src/main/java/com/jeeplus/modules/warehouse/ledger/service/LedgerService.java
View file @
b8309d91
...
...
@@ -148,6 +148,14 @@ public class LedgerService extends CrudService<LedgerMapper, Ledger> {
oldLeger
.
setShelvesIds
(
newSIds
);
oldLeger
.
setNum
(
oldLeger
.
getNum
()
+
num
);
oldLeger
.
setSum
(
oldLeger
.
getSum
().
add
(
sum
));
List
<
LedgerInfo
>
oldLedgerInfos
=
oldLeger
.
getLedgerInfoList
();
if
(
null
!=
oldLedgerInfos
)
{
List
<
LedgerInfo
>
newLedgerInfos
=
new
ArrayList
<>();
newLedgerInfos
.
addAll
(
oldLedgerInfos
);
newLedgerInfos
.
addAll
(
ledger
.
getLedgerInfoList
());
oldLeger
.
setLedgerInfoList
(
newLedgerInfos
);
}
oldLeger
.
preUpdate
();
mapper
.
update
(
oldLeger
);
ledger
=
oldLeger
;
...
...
src/main/java/com/jeeplus/modules/warehouse/qrcode/mapper/xml/QrCodeMapper.xml
View file @
b8309d91
...
...
@@ -220,7 +220,6 @@
type.code AS "goodsInfo.type.code",
type.name AS "goodsInfo.type.name",
gi.id AS "goodsInfo.id",
gi.NAME AS "goodsInfo.name",
gi.model AS "goodsInfo.model",
gi.amount AS "goodsInfo.amount",
...
...
src/main/java/com/jeeplus/modules/warehouse/storage/service/StorageService.java
View file @
b8309d91
...
...
@@ -222,7 +222,9 @@ public class StorageService extends CrudService<StorageMapper, Storage> {
* @return
*/
@Transactional
(
readOnly
=
false
)
public
Page
<
StorageInfo
>
findByPcTypeModel
(
Page
<
StorageInfo
>
page
,
StorageInfo
si
)
{
public
Page
<
StorageInfo
>
findByPcTypeModel
(
Page
<
QrCode
>
page
,
StorageInfo
si
)
{
GoodsInfo
goodsInfo
=
si
.
getGoodsInfo
();
QrCode
temQr
=
new
QrCode
();
String
model
=
goodsInfo
.
getModel
();
...
...
@@ -235,6 +237,8 @@ public class StorageService extends CrudService<StorageMapper, Storage> {
if
(
null
!=
qr
&&
StringUtils
.
isNotBlank
(
qr
.
getState
()))
{
temQr
.
setState
(
qr
.
getState
());
}
dataRuleFilter
(
temQr
);
temQr
.
setPage
(
page
);
List
<
QrCode
>
qrCodeList
=
qrCodeMapper
.
findByPcTypeModel
(
temQr
);
List
<
StorageInfo
>
storageInfoList
=
new
ArrayList
<>();
...
...
@@ -249,7 +253,14 @@ public class StorageService extends CrudService<StorageMapper, Storage> {
storageInfo
.
setQrCode
(
qrCode
);
storageInfoList
.
add
(
storageInfo
);
}
page
.
setList
(
storageInfoList
);
return
page
;
Page
<
StorageInfo
>
storageInfoPage
=
new
Page
<>();
storageInfoPage
.
setList
(
storageInfoList
);
storageInfoPage
.
setCount
(
page
.
getCount
());
storageInfoPage
.
setPageNo
(
page
.
getPageNo
());
storageInfoPage
.
setPageSize
(
page
.
getPageSize
());
storageInfoPage
.
setOrderBy
(
page
.
getOrderBy
());
storageInfoPage
.
setFuncName
(
page
.
getFuncName
());
storageInfoPage
.
setFuncParam
(
page
.
getFuncParam
());
return
storageInfoPage
;
}
}
\ No newline at end of file
src/main/java/com/jeeplus/modules/warehouse/storage/web/StorageController.java
View file @
b8309d91
...
...
@@ -273,7 +273,7 @@ public class StorageController extends BaseController {
public
Map
<
String
,
Object
>
findByPcTypeModel
(
HttpServletRequest
request
,
HttpServletResponse
response
,
StorageInfo
storageInfo
)
{
GoodsInfo
goodsInfo
=
storageInfo
.
getGoodsInfo
();
if
(
null
!=
goodsInfo
&&
null
!=
goodsInfo
.
getGoods
()
&&
null
!=
goodsInfo
.
getType
()
&&
StringUtils
.
isNotBlank
(
goodsInfo
.
getGoods
().
getBatchNum
())
&&
StringUtils
.
isNotBlank
(
goodsInfo
.
getType
().
getId
()))
{
Page
<
StorageInfo
>
page
=
storageService
.
findByPcTypeModel
(
new
Page
<
StorageInfo
>(
request
,
response
),
storageInfo
);
Page
<
StorageInfo
>
page
=
storageService
.
findByPcTypeModel
(
new
Page
<
QrCode
>(
request
,
response
),
storageInfo
);
return
getBootstrapData
(
page
);
}
else
{
return
null
;
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ment